Q. What are the most important factors to consider when setting up and maintaining a turtle and fish aquarium?
A. When setting up and maintaining a turtle and fish aquarium, there are several important factors to consider. First, you should make sure that the tank is large enough to accommodate both types of animals. It is important to provide plenty of space for the fish and turtles to swim and explore. Additionally, you should make sure that the water is clean and free of contaminants or pollutants. The water temperature should also be monitored and kept at an appropriate level for both the fish and turtles. Finally, it is important to provide adequate filtration to keep the water clean and to maintain a healthy environment for both the fish and turtles.

Q. Are there any special filtration requirements for a turtle and fish aquarium?
A. Yes, there are a few special filtration requirements for a turtle and fish aquarium. It is important to use an effective filter that is designed to handle both types of animals, as they both have different needs when it comes to water quality. Additionally, using an ultraviolet light in the tank can help keep the water clean and free of harmful bacteria.
Q. How often should I change the water in my turtle and fish aquarium?
A. It is important to change the water in your turtle and fish aquarium at least once a week. This will help keep the water clean and free of toxins that can be harmful to your animals. Additionally, it is important to check the water parameters (such as pH, nitrate, and ammonia levels) regularly to ensure that they are within an acceptable range for both the fish and turtles.
